Njengoba isabelo semakethe sezimoto zikagesi siqhubeka nokukhula, abenzi bezimoto bashintsha kancane kancane ukugxila kwabo kwe-R&D kumabhethri kagesi kanye nokulawula okuhlakaniphile. Ngenxa yezici zamakhemikhali zebhethri likagesi, izinga lokushisa lizoba nomthelela omkhulu ekusebenzeni kokushaja nokukhipha ishaja kanye nokuphepha kwebhethri likagesi. Ngakho-ke, ekuthuthukisweni kwezimoto zikagesi, ukwakheka kohlelo lokuphatha ukushisa kwebhethri kubaluleke kakhulu. Ngokusekelwe esakhiweni sesistimu yokuphatha ukushisa kwebhethri likagesi esikhona, kuhlanganiswe nobuchwepheshe besistimu yepompo yokushisa ye-Tesla yezindlela eziyisishiyagalombili, isimiso sokusebenza sebhethri likagesi kanye nezinzuzo kanye nokungalungi kohlelo lokuphatha ukushisa kuyahlaziywa. Kunezinkinga ezifana nokulahlekelwa amandla emoto ebandayo, ibanga elifushane lokuhamba, kanye namandla okushaja ancishisiwe, futhi kuphakanyiswa uhlelo lokwenza ngcono uhlelo lokuphatha ukushisa lwebhethri likagesi.

Asikho isisombululo esingcono esitholiwe. Ngokungafani nezimoto zikaphethiloli zendabuko, izimoto zikagesi azikwazi ukusebenzisa ukushisa okulahliwe ukushisa ikhabhini kanye nebhethri. Ngakho-ke, ezimotweni zikagesi, yonke imisebenzi yokushisa idinga ukuqedwa ngokusebenzisa imithombo yokushisa kanye namandla. Ngakho-ke, indlela yokuthuthukisa ukusetshenziswa kwamandla asele emoto iba yinto kagesi. Inkinga enkulu ngezinhlelo zokuphatha ukushisa kwezimoto.
Iuhlelo lokuphatha ukushisa kwezimoto zikagesiilawula izinga lokushisa lezingxenye ezahlukene zemoto ngokulawula ukuhamba kokushisa, ikakhulukazi okuhlanganisa nokulawulwa kwezinga lokushisa kwemoto, ibhethri kanye ne-cockpit. Uhlelo lwebhethri kanye ne-cockpit kudingeka kucatshangelwe ukulungiswa okubili kokubanda nokushisa, kuyilapho uhlelo lwemoto ludinga kuphela ukucabangela ukushabalaliswa kokushisa. Iningi lezinhlelo zokuqala zokuphatha ukushisa zezimoto zikagesi kwakuyizinhlelo zokushabalaliswa kokushisa ezipholile emoyeni. Lolu hlobo lohlelo lokuphatha ukushisa lwathatha ukulungiswa kwezinga lokushisa kwe-cockpit njengomgomo oyinhloko wokuklama uhlelo, futhi kwakungavamile ukubhekwa njengokulawulwa kwezinga lokushisa kwemoto nebhethri, ukuchitha amandla ohlelo olunezinjini ezintathu ngesikhathi sokusebenza. Njengoba amandla emoto nebhethri ekhula, uhlelo lokushabalaliswa kokushisa olupholile emoyeni alusakwazi ukuhlangabezana nezidingo eziyisisekelo zokuphathwa kokushisa kwemoto, futhi uhlelo lokuphatha ukushisa selungene enkathini yokupholisa uketshezi. Uhlelo lokupholisa uketshezi alugcini nje ngokuthuthukisa ukusebenza kahle kokushabalaliswa kokushisa, kodwa futhi lukhulisa uhlelo lokuvikela ibhethri. Ngokulawula umzimba we-valve, uhlelo lokupholisa uketshezi alukwazi ukulawula kuphela indlela yokushisa, kodwa futhi lusebenzise ngokugcwele amandla angaphakathi emotweni.
Ukushisa kwebhethri kanye ne-cockpit kuhlukaniswe kakhulu ngezindlela ezintathu zokushisa: ukushisa kwe-thermistor ye-temperature coefficient (PTC), ukushisa kwefilimu yokushisa kagesi kanye nokushisa kwephampu yokushisa. Ngenxa yezici zamakhemikhali zebhethri yamandla ezimoto zikagesi, kuzoba nezinkinga ezifana nokulahlekelwa amandla emoto ebandayo, ibanga elifushane lokuhamba, kanye namandla okushaja ancishisiwe ngaphansi kwezimo zokushisa eziphansi. Ukuze kuqinisekiswe ukuthi izimoto zikagesi zingafinyelela izimo zokusebenza ezifanele ngaphansi kwezimo ezahlukahlukene ezimbi kakhulu, Ukuze kuhlangatshezwane nezidingo zokusetshenziswa, uhlelo lokuphatha ukushisa kwebhethri ludinga ukuthuthukiswa futhi lulungiselelwe izimo zokushisa eziphansi.
Indlela yokupholisa ibhethri
Ngokusho kwemidiya ehlukene yokudlulisa ukushisa, uhlelo lokuphatha ukushisa kwebhethri lungahlukaniswa ngezinhlobo ezintathu: uhlelo lokuphatha ukushisa komoya ophakathi nendawo, uhlelo lokuphatha ukushisa koketshezi ophakathi nendawo kanye nohlelo lokuphatha ukushisa kwezinto zokushintsha kwesigaba, kanye nohlelo lokuphatha ukushisa komoya ophakathi nendawo lungahlukaniswa ngohlelo lokupholisa lwemvelo kanye nohlelo lokupholisa umoya. Kunezinhlobo ezimbili zohlelo lokupholisa.
Ukushisa kwe-PTC thermistor kudinga ukuhlela iyunithi yokushisa ye-PTC thermistor kanye ne-insulating coating ezungeze iphakethe lebhethri. Uma iphakethe lebhethri lemoto lidinga ukufudunyezwa, uhlelo lunika amandla i-PTC thermistor ukuze ikhiqize ukushisa, bese luvunguza umoya nge-PTC ngefeni (Isifudumezi Sokupholisa se-PTC/Isifudumezi Somoya se-PTC). Amafin okushisa e-thermistor ayayifudumeza, bese ekugcineni eqondisa umoya oshisayo ephaketheni lebhethri ukuze ujikeleze ngaphakathi, ngaleyo ndlela kufudunyezwe ibhethri.
